WATERSIDERS' PICNIC.

SHIPPING HELD UP.

For the second time within a week the shipping of the-Port of Lyttelton was held up yesterday owing to the watersiders' annual picnic.. The picnic was originally arranged for Wednesday last, that being the day, th© fourth Wednesday in January, provided for in the 1 award. However, Wednesday was a wet day and the picnio was postponed. No other day is provided in the 'award in. the ©vent of the fourth Wednesday in January being wet, but a general meeting of tb© Waterside H orkers' Union was held, and it was decided to hold the picnic yesterday. No labour was offering when the call was made yesterday morning, suid watersidei-s engaged on Saturday morning for work on the Nowshera, and ordered back tor *8 o'clock yesterday morning did not appear. This last is alleged to have constituted a breach of the award.

In all two overseas- steamers, ail intercolonial cargo steamer' and four coastal steamers were held up. The position was rather serious for the small steamer Cvgnct, which has 1300 c-a|;ea of jfr.uit from Nejson in her holds. With tli© intense, heat of the List two days tho delay is likely to prove disastrous to the consignment, some of which is intended for Invercargill.

Ill© seamen were also Affected by tho picnic. According to the seamen's award the men shall be granted a day's holiday a year or the day of the watersiders picnic, at whichever port they liappen to be in. Tho mon in most of the local steamers were granted this holiday yesterday, but in on© case the men were asked to do a little neoessary work, but refused.
